如何搭建自己的服务器6
-
搭建自己的服务器是一个复杂而且需要专业知识的过程,但如果你有一定的技术基础和对网络架构有一定的了解,那么你可以尝试自己搭建一个服务器来满足自己的需求。下面是一个简单的步骤来帮助你搭建自己的服务器。
第一步:选择硬件和操作系统
首先,你需要选择合适的硬件和操作系统来建立你的服务器。硬件方面,你可以选择自己组装一台服务器或者购买一台预装了操作系统的服务器。操作系统方面,通常人们选择Linux操作系统,比如Ubuntu或者CentOS,因为它们是开源的且稳定性较高。第二步:准备网络环境
在搭建服务器之前,你需要确保自己拥有一个稳定的网络连接,并且配置好相关的网络设置,比如IP地址、DNS服务器等等。第三步:安装和配置服务器软件
安装和配置服务器软件是服务器搭建的重要一步。根据你的需求,可以选择安装不同的软件,比如Web服务器(比如Nginx或者Apache)、数据库服务器(比如MySQL或者PostgreSQL)等。在安装软件的过程中,你需要按照相应的文档指引进行操作,并根据需要进行配置。第四步:设置安全性和防护措施
为了保护服务器的安全,你需要设置相关的安全性和防护措施,比如安装防火墙、配置入侵检测系统、设置访问权限等。第五步:测试和优化服务器性能
一旦你的服务器搭建好了,你需要测试服务器的性能并进行优化。可以使用一些性能测试工具来测试服务器的负载能力和响应速度,并根据测试结果进行相应的优化。第六步:备份服务器数据
最后,你需要定期备份服务器的数据,以防止数据丢失或者硬件故障。可以使用一些备份工具来自动备份服务器数据,并将备份数据保存在不同的位置。总结:
搭建自己的服务器是一个复杂而且需要专业知识的过程,但如果你愿意花时间和精力去学习和实践,你就可以成功搭建自己的服务器。在搭建过程中,记得随时保持对服务器的安全性和性能的关注,并定期进行备份以保护服务器数据。1年前 -
搭建自己的服务器是一个充满挑战和充实的过程。这个过程需要具备一定的技术知识和技能,并且需要时间和耐心。下面是搭建自己的服务器的一些步骤和要点。
-
选择硬件和操作系统:首先需要选择适合服务器的硬件和操作系统。服务器硬件要求高性能、稳定可靠,并且根据需求选择适当的规模,例如处理器、内存和存储空间等。操作系统有许多选择,例如Windows Server、Linux等。根据自己的需求和熟悉程度选择合适的操作系统。
-
网络设置:服务器必须与互联网连接,因此需要进行网络设置。这涉及到选择合适的网络服务提供商(ISP),安装和配置网络设备,如路由器和交换机,以及设置网络连接。确保服务器能够稳定地连接到互联网。
-
安全设置:服务器安全至关重要。在搭建服务器之前,应该学习和了解服务器安全的基本知识,并采取相应的安全措施。例如,设置强密码、 添加防火墙、定期更新操作系统和应用程序等。还可以考虑使用TLS/SSL证书来保护从服务器到终端用户的通信。
-
配置服务器软件:一旦服务器硬件和操作系统都准备好了,接下来需要配置服务器软件。根据自己的需求和用途,选择合适的服务器软件。例如,如果需要搭建网站,则可以使用Apache、Nginx等作为Web服务器;如果需要搭建数据库,则可以选择MySQL、PostgreSQL等。配置服务器软件需要了解软件的配置文件和参数,并进行相应的设置。
-
设置域名和DNS:如果你想要通过域名来访问你的服务器,那么需要设置域名和DNS。首先,注册一个域名并将其指向你的服务器的IP地址。然后,在DNS设置中添加相应的记录,将域名解析到服务器的IP地址。这样,当用户通过域名访问你的服务器时,DNS将把请求转发到正确的IP地址。
-
监控和维护:一旦服务器搭建完成,还需要进行监控和维护工作。监控服务器的性能和运行状态,例如CPU和内存的使用率、网络流量等。定期检查服务器的日志并进行必要的维护,例如删除过期的日志文件、清理临时文件等。及时更新操作系统和软件,以修复安全漏洞和改进性能。
搭建自己的服务器需要一定的技术知识和经验,但通过仔细规划和学习,你可以成功地搭建一个强大、高性能和安全的服务器。尽管搭建服务器可能需要一些时间和精力,但它将为你提供更多自由和控制权,使你能够根据自己的需求来定制和管理服务器。
1年前 -
-
标题:如何搭建自己的服务器6
引言:
在现代科技快速发展的时代,拥有自己的服务器已经成为越来越多人的需求。搭建自己的服务器可以提供更高的安全性、可靠性和灵活性,也可以为个人和企业的数据存储、网站托管和应用程序提供更好的支持。本文将介绍如何搭建自己的服务器,包括硬件选择、操作系统安装、网络设置和远程访问等。一、硬件选择
-
选择合适的服务器硬件:
搭建自己的服务器首先要选择合适的硬件。服务器硬件包括主机(服务器框架)、处理器、内存、硬盘和电源等组件。根据自己的需求和预算来选择硬件规格,如处理器的核心数、内存的大小和硬盘的容量等。 -
考虑服务器的扩展性:
同时,也要考虑服务器的扩展性,尽量选择支持更多硬件组件的主板和机箱。同时要选择支持RAID磁盘阵列的硬盘控制器,以提供更好的数据备份和冗余功能。
二、操作系统安装
-
选择合适的操作系统:
根据自己的需要选择合适的操作系统。常见的服务器操作系统包括Windows Server、Linux和Unix等。根据不同的操作系统,选择相应的版本和发行版。 -
安装操作系统:
使用安装光盘或U盘启动服务器,在启动菜单中选择从光盘或U盘启动。根据提示选择语言、时区、键盘布局等设置。然后选择安装目录和分区,完成操作系统的安装。
三、网络设置
-
配置网络连接:
连接服务器和路由器的网络线缆,确保服务器和局域网连接正常。在操作系统中配置网络连接,设置IP地址、子网掩码、网关和DNS服务器等信息。 -
配置防火墙和端口转发:
根据实际需求,配置防火墙和端口转发。防火墙可以保护服务器免受恶意攻击,端口转发可以将外部请求引导到服务器上的特定应用程序。
四、远程访问
-
配置远程桌面:
配置远程桌面可以通过远程连接来管理服务器。在操作系统中启用远程桌面,并设置允许远程连接的用户和权限。 -
配置SSH访问:
SSH是一种安全的远程访问协议,可以提供加密的连接和身份验证。在Linux服务器中,配置SSH访问可以通过终端访问服务器。
五、数据备份和恢复
-
配置定期备份:
配置服务器的定期备份可以保护重要数据的安全。可以使用内置的备份工具,也可以使用第三方备份软件。 -
测试备份和恢复:
定期测试备份和恢复过程,确保备份可用性和恢复的准确性。定期检查备份文件的完整性,并进行恢复测试,以确保在数据丢失时可以快速恢复。
结论:
搭建自己的服务器可以提供更高的安全性、可靠性和灵活性,也可以为个人和企业的数据存储、网站托管和应用程序提供更好的支持。通过选择合适的硬件、安装操作系统、配置网络和远程访问以及定期备份和恢复,可以成功搭建自己的服务器。不过在搭建服务器的过程中,建议参考相关的教程和文档,以确保操作的正确性和安全性。1年前 -